Matty Dodd will surely be remembered as one of the most popular players of Paul Holleran's time at Leamington. Signed late in the 2011/12 campaign he went on to play a big part in the Southern League title win of the following season, scoring 12 goals including a hat trick of penalties in a 4-1 win at Cambridge City, the ground on which he made his debut for Brakes. He also played a major role in our first season back at Step 2, and first in the Conference North, and made a further 30 appearances the following season before leaving for Stourbridge.
Despite switching to a big rival Matty was still held in high regard by Brakes fans, and hilariously invaded the pitch at Redditch along with Richard Batchelor and several Brakes fans after Courtney Baker-Richardson's 94th minute equaliser in the play off semi final in 2016.
Having scored the winning goal for the Glassboys in their FA Trophy win at the Phillips 66 Community Stadium in the December of the 2017/18 season, Paul Holleran brought Matty back to the club in a deal to the end of the season, and he played a pivotal role, scoring the goal that kept us in the division in the penultimate game at York City.
